Table of Contents

DMSLBM History

References

Update History

CMS File Input : DMSLBM ASSEMBLE
Date : 12/12/1978 8:29:00 AM
VM Context : MAINT(393)
File Name : DMSLBM.ASSEMBLE.Z1.txt
Modified : 1/16/2021 7:31:31 AM
Created : 1/16/2021 7:31:31 AM

Update Order

  1. R08993DS 601 DMSLBM DOESN'T HANDLE MACLIB DIRECTORIES BIGGER THAN 8000 BYTES
  2. R12809DS 620 UV04126 ERROR WHEN COMPRESS EMPTY MACLIB TWO TIMES.
  3. R13802DS 623 UV04998 NO MSDMSLBM013W FOR MACLIB DEL OF NONEXISTENT XXX.
  4. HRC015DS H40 Replace hardcoded constants in STATEFST with symbolic offsets

R08993DS

Date Tuesday Dec 19, 1978 12:19:00 PM
Loaded from MAINT(193)
       R08993DS: ./ I 967000 $
       R08993DS:          SR    RG9,RG9              INITIALIZE REG 9           @VA08993
       R08993DS: ./ R 968000 $
       R08993DS:          ICM   RG9,3,BUFFER+10      GET LENGTH OF MACRO DICT.  @VA08993
 BEGIN APPLY >>> ./ I 967000 $
   END APPLY >>> ./ I 967000 $
 BEGIN APPLY >>> ./ R 968000 $
   END APPLY >>> ./ R 968000 $
Update Succeeded
Update Execution Time 16 milliseconds.

R12809DS

Date Friday Apr 10, 1981 04:10:00 AM
Loaded from MAINT(193)
       R12809DS: ./ I 00053000          $ 00053500 500
       R12809DS: *           LIBRARY IS ERASED IF LAST MEMBER IS DELETED        @VA12809
       R12809DS: ./ R 00186000          $ 00186000 500
       R12809DS: *        REMAIN IN THE LIBRARY FILE UNTIL COMPACTED. THE       @VA12809
       R12809DS: *        LIBRARY IS ERASED IF THE LAST MEMBER IS DELETED.      @VA12809
       R12809DS: ./ I 00716000          $ 00716010 10
       R12809DS:          TM    FLAG,NOMEMBER HAVE WE FOUND A MEMBER YET?       @VA12809
       R12809DS:          BNO   SRCHOVER       YES, DON'T SEARCH ANY FURTHER    @VA12809
       R12809DS:          CR    RG7,RG9        ARE WE AT END OF DICTIONARY?     @VA12809
       R12809DS:          BNL   ERASELIB       YES, NO MEMBERS LEFT, DELETE LIB @VA12809
       R12809DS: SEEKMEMB EQU   *                                               @VA12809
       R12809DS:          CLC   0(8,RG7),=8X'00' IS THIS A NULL ENTRY?          @VA12809
       R12809DS:          BE    SKPRESET       YES, GO SET UP FOR THE NEXT ONE  @VA12809
       R12809DS:          NI    FLAG,255-NOMEMBER NO, LIBRARY IS NOT EMPTY      @VA12809
       R12809DS:          B     SRCHOVER       MEMBER FOUND, SEARCH OVER        @VA12809
       R12809DS: SKPRESET EQU   *                                               @VA12809
       R12809DS:          BXLE  RG7,RG8,SEEKMEMB GO TRY THE NEXT ONE            @VA12809
       R12809DS: ERASELIB EQU   *                                               @VA12809
       R12809DS:          LA    R1,OUT         POINT TO OUTPUT FILE             @VA12809
       R12809DS:          MVC   0(8,R1),=CL8'ERASE' SET UP TO ERASE LIBRARY     @VA12809
       R12809DS:          SVC   202            AND DO IT                        @VA12809
       R12809DS:          DC    AL4(*+4)                                        @VA12809
       R12809DS:          B     ERR213W        GO TELL USER LIBRARY ERASED      @VA12809
       R12809DS: SRCHOVER EQU   *                                               @VA12809
       R12809DS: ./ I 00998000          $ 00998500 500
       R12809DS:          OI    FLAG,NOMEMBER IN CASE WE DELETE LAST MEMBER     @VA12809
       R12809DS: ./ I 01005000          $ 01005200 200
       R12809DS:          CLC   0(8,RG7),=8X'00' NO, THEN IS THIS A NULL ENTRY? @VA12809
       R12809DS:          BE    CONTSEEK       YES, KEEP LOOKING                @VA12809
       R12809DS:          NI    FLAG,255-NOMEMBER NO, SHOW LIB IS NOT EMPTY     @VA12809
       R12809DS: CONTSEEK EQU   *                                               @VA12809
       R12809DS: ./ R 01039000          $ 01039000 500
       R12809DS:          DMSERR TEXT='LIBRARY ''........'' MACLIB NOT CREATED, OR ERASEX
       R12809DS:                D IF NO MEMBERS LEFT',                          @VA12809X
       R12809DS: ./ I 01275800          $ 01275830 30
       R12809DS: FLAG     DC    X'00'          FLAG BYTE                        @VA12809
       R12809DS: NOMEMBER EQU   X'08'          NO MEMBERS LEFT IN LIBRARY       @VA12809
 BEGIN APPLY >>> ./ I 00053000          $ 00053500 500
   END APPLY >>> ./ I 00053000          $ 00053500 500
 BEGIN APPLY >>> ./ R 00186000          $ 00186000 500
   END APPLY >>> ./ R 00186000          $ 00186000 500
 BEGIN APPLY >>> ./ I 00716000          $ 00716010 10
   END APPLY >>> ./ I 00716000          $ 00716010 10
 BEGIN APPLY >>> ./ I 00998000          $ 00998500 500
   END APPLY >>> ./ I 00998000          $ 00998500 500
 BEGIN APPLY >>> ./ I 01005000          $ 01005200 200
   END APPLY >>> ./ I 01005000          $ 01005200 200
 BEGIN APPLY >>> ./ R 01039000          $ 01039000 500
   END APPLY >>> ./ R 01039000          $ 01039000 500
 BEGIN APPLY >>> ./ I 01275800          $ 01275830 30
   END APPLY >>> ./ I 01275800          $ 01275830 30
Update Succeeded
Update Execution Time 31 milliseconds.

R13802DS

Date Wednesday Aug 05, 1981 07:24:00 AM
Loaded from MAINT(193)
       R13802DS: ./ R 01004000 01005000 $ 01004000 500
       R13802DS: SEEKLP   EQU   *                                               @VA13802
       R13802DS: ./ I 01005800          $ 01005900 50
       R13802DS:          CLC   0(8,RG7),0(PLIST)   IS THIS THE ONE             @VA13802
       R13802DS:          BCR   8,SUBR         BR ON YES                        @VA13802
 BEGIN APPLY >>> ./ R 01004000 01005000 $ 01004000 500
   END APPLY >>> ./ R 01004000 01005000 $ 01004000 500
 BEGIN APPLY >>> ./ I 01005800          $ 01005900 50
   END APPLY >>> ./ I 01005800          $ 01005900 50
Update Succeeded
Update Execution Time 16 milliseconds.

HRC015DS

Date Sunday Mar 11, 2018 06:54:00 PM
Loaded from MAINT(093)
       HRC015DS: ./ R 00931000          $ 00931100 100
       HRC015DS:          L     TEMP,FVSFSTAD-STATEFST(TEMP) Get ADT for file   HRC015DS
       HRC015DS: ./ I 01350000          $ 01350100 100
       HRC015DS:          FVS                                                   HRC015DS
 BEGIN APPLY >>> ./ R 00931000          $ 00931100 100
   END APPLY >>> ./ R 00931000          $ 00931100 100
 BEGIN APPLY >>> ./ I 01350000          $ 01350100 100
   END APPLY >>> ./ I 01350000          $ 01350100 100
Update Succeeded
Update Execution Time 23 milliseconds.